Kristin Hersh to appear with Dave Narcizo at Charter Books Sept. 3

Kristin Hersh, a Newport native who co-founded the legendary alt-rock band Throwing Muses with her stepsister Tanya Donelly, will appear for a conversation with bandmate and drummer Dave Narcizo on September 3rd.
